In Thailand, The Cultural Exchange Project's language camps provide English language education to disadvantaged youth. This gives them an opportunity to learn an important skill that they can use to better their lives. These language camps mostly take place in and around schools. Students are offered a chance to practice their English in a more creative set of activities and learning that make the day a lot more fun.
During the camp days, you will participate in many creative activities using art and music with the children. You will also have time for plenty of exercise playing soccer during activity time. It’s the Thai kids’ favorite sport.

What will I do each day? |
Counselors will arrive in Bangkok and check into accommodations for orientation. Counselors will travel to different schools and locations throughout Thailand and participate in English camps for disadvantaged children. |
The Cultural Exchange Project provides a 2-day orientation program that covers Thai language, culture, and society. There is also one day or “hands-on” experience. |
How does The Cultural Exchange Project choose the location of the camps? |
Camps are normally run from a local school and as part of a school day. Schools apply in advance to be considered for a visit by GeoVisions counselors. |

Do I need a visa? |
You will enter on the "O" visa for volunteers. The Cultural Exchange Project will help you with this process. The current cost for this visa is $80 US. The "O" visa is good for 90-days. |
